YOUR ROLE
Fully manage and lead product analysis and testing while documenting progress and results in the LIM systems
Provide technical support to customer and analyze results after product release
Record, organize and communicate results/data from experiments and testing
Explore new technology, product, or performance improvement opportunities
Observe safety and environmental guidelines while handling products
Perform data analysis, draw conclusions, and make experimental recommendations
Maintain laboratory and storage areas, as well as equipment
Ensure adherence to all applicable environmental, health and safety regulations, standards and policies
Actively participate in scientific publications and forums
Collaborate closely with product management, production and sourcing teams to develop new products and nurture current product lines through product
Support manufacturing to ensure quality product delivery
Effectively communicate with stakeholders and leverage their feedback to optimize processes towards customer requirements
Attend or present technical work at business meetings and conferences
Lead acquisition integration Product Development topics
YOUR SKILLS
Master’s or PhD degree in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, Polymer Sciences and Materials Science, is highly preferred.
Preferred 10 years or more of experience in the areas of thermoset materials and adhesive formulations.
Strong oral and written communication skills, and excellent interpersonal skills are essential.
Proven track-record to invent and innovate, and strong ability to design and implement experiments are needed.
Professional laboratory skills are essential.
The ability to work autonomously on multiple projects is needed.
The salary for this role is $110,000.00-$130,000.00 This is the range that we in good faith anticipate relying on when setting wages for this position. We may ultimately pay more or less than the posted range and this range. This salary range may also be modified in the future.
